Directed by Sailesh Kolanu, this sequel to HIT: The First Case follows Krishna Dev (KD), a laid-back SP in the Homicide Intervention Team (HIT) in Visakhapatnam.

Plot: KD must track down a serial killer responsible for gruesome, dismembered murders. The stakes become personal when the threat reaches his girlfriend, Aarya.

Cast: Adivi Sesh, Meenakshi Chaudhary, Rao Ramesh, and Suhas. Rating: The film holds a solid 7.2/10 on IMDb. Why Avoid Filmyzilla and Pirate Sites?

Government and ISP Actions Against Filmyzilla

The Indian government, through the Department of Telecommunications (DoT) and the Ministry of Electronics & IT (MeitY), regularly blocks piracy websites. In fact, Filmyzilla has been banned in India multiple times. However, the site keeps resurfacing with new mirror domains (e.g., filmyzilla.boats, filmyzilla.lol, etc.).

ISPs like Jio, Airtel, and BSNL are now required to block access to such sites. If you try to visit Filmyzilla, you will often see a warning page from your ISP. Ignoring that warning and using VPNs to bypass the block is still illegal.
